Title: Innovations and Contributions of Kenneth C. Nitz

Introduction

Kenneth C. Nitz is an accomplished inventor based in Redwood City, CA, with an impressive portfolio of 20 patents. His work primarily focuses on advancements in social engineering attack detection and the coordination of virtual personal assistant applications, contributing significantly to the fields of cybersecurity and artificial intelligence.

Latest Patents

Among Kenneth's latest innovations is the patent for "Conversation-depth social engineering attack detection using attributes from automated dialog engagement." This method revolutionizes the way adversarial attacks are identified by engaging in deep dialogues with adversarial actors, thus analyzing communication patterns to create a playbook that enhances the detection and mitigation of such attacks.

Another notable invention is the "Providing virtual personal assistance with multiple VPA applications," which streamlines interactions between users and different virtual personal assistants. By coordinating various portions of conversational dialog across multiple VPAs, Kenneth's work optimizes user engagement with technology.
